我有一个跨越4种服务器类型的SpringCloud微服务应用程序:一个安全网关、两个UI服务器和一个RESTAPI服务器。其中每一个都将在生产环境中的自己的VM上运行:REST服务器的4个服务器实例和每个其他服务器的2个实例。该系统预计将为大约30,000名用户提供服务。服务发现由Eureka提供。我有两个用于故障转移的Eureka服务器。共享HTTPsession由SpringSession和SpringDataRedis提供,在参与服务器上使用@EnableRedisHttpSession注释。我决定为Redis设置3个虚拟机(“示例2:使用三个盒子的基本设置”,网址为:http:
@TOC背景现在微服务开发模式应用的越来越广泛,注册中心Eureka也逐渐被其它注册中心产品替代,比如阿里出品的Nacos。随着云原生相关技术的普及,k8s迅猛发展,我们把K8s中的Pod暴露给外部访问,通过少了Service,这也是今天的主角。有没有发现,其实Service已经解决了Pod的注册与发现的问题,并且也实现了负载,我们在基于云原生开发微服务的时候,可以利用Service的能力,获取后面的Pod列表,通过Ribbon等客户端负载对Pod发起调用,也可以直接利用Service的负载能力进行调用。k8s内部会使用ETCD服务维护这些信息的变化。Spring官网也为k8s提供了一套原生的
作者:张凯@阿里云、陳韋廷@Intel、周渊@Intel简介ApacheCeleborn(Incubating)是阿里云捐赠给Apache的通用RemoteShuffleService,旨在提升大数据计算引擎的性能/稳定性/弹性,目前已广泛应用于生产场景。Gluten是Intel开源的引擎加速项目,旨在通过把SparkJavaEngine替换为NativeEngine(Velox,ClickHouse,Arrow等)来加速Spark引擎。过去一段时间,Gluten社区和Celeborn社区相互合作,成功把Celeborn集成进Gluten,本文将对此加以介绍。Gluten:给Spark换上Na
通过object.saveEventually(),我将能够将本地存储中的数据与Parse中的云同步。但这是我感到困惑的地方,在文档中,它声明:Whenanobjectispinned,everytimeyouupdateitbyfetchingorsavingnewdata,thecopyinthelocaldatastorewillbeupdatedautomatically但是,接下来的例子,几段之后,取消固定所有对象,然后通过固定名称为HighScores的新scores数组来更新HighScores/p>PFQuery*query=[PFQueryqueryWithClass
通过object.saveEventually(),我将能够将本地存储中的数据与Parse中的云同步。但这是我感到困惑的地方,在文档中,它声明:Whenanobjectispinned,everytimeyouupdateitbyfetchingorsavingnewdata,thecopyinthelocaldatastorewillbeupdatedautomatically但是,接下来的例子,几段之后,取消固定所有对象,然后通过固定名称为HighScores的新scores数组来更新HighScores/p>PFQuery*query=[PFQueryqueryWithClass
我正在尝试了解新的ParseServer并已部署在Heroku上。这很顺利,但我正在努力解决如何编写服务器端代码(云代码)。我已经多次阅读解析服务器示例,所以我一定遗漏了一些东西,但我很不清楚我是否应该使用Express来做某事,或者我什至如何开始包含我的CloudCode文件。非常感谢任何帮助。更新:我在错误的地方找到了我正在寻找的云文件夹。我将它和index.js移到了桌面上我的应用程序文件夹中。我已将main.js中的默认代码更改为我的自定义代码。我已经用我的应用程序信息设置了index.js。现在的问题是,当我运行应用程序并尝试调用云代码函数时,我得到错误无效函数。
我正在尝试了解新的ParseServer并已部署在Heroku上。这很顺利,但我正在努力解决如何编写服务器端代码(云代码)。我已经多次阅读解析服务器示例,所以我一定遗漏了一些东西,但我很不清楚我是否应该使用Express来做某事,或者我什至如何开始包含我的CloudCode文件。非常感谢任何帮助。更新:我在错误的地方找到了我正在寻找的云文件夹。我将它和index.js移到了桌面上我的应用程序文件夹中。我已将main.js中的默认代码更改为我的自定义代码。我已经用我的应用程序信息设置了index.js。现在的问题是,当我运行应用程序并尝试调用云代码函数时,我得到错误无效函数。
第一章开发环境搭建目录第一章开发环境搭建前言一、RuoYi-Cloud是什么?二、环境部署1.安装JDK2.安装docker3.下载mysql镜像4.下载redis镜像5.下载nacos-server 镜像6.安装node.js三、项目启动前言开发设备: MacBookPro(14英寸,2021年) 系统版本:macOSMonterey 芯片:AppleM1Pro 内存:16GB开发相关工具: ideaIU-2022.3.2-aarch64 navicat161_premium_en一、RuoYi-Cloud是
我目前正在开发一款应用,我必须在其中从Google的Firestore检索数据。我的数据结构是这样的:users-name@xxx.com-moredata有没有办法让我把name@xxx.com改成名字?我看不到更改文档名称的方法。 最佳答案 我认为最好的方法是从'name@xxx.com'获取数据并将其上传到一个名为'name'的新文档,然后删除旧文档。举个例子:constfirestore=firebase.firestore();//getthedatafrom'name@xxx.com'firestore.collecti
我目前正在开发一款应用,我必须在其中从Google的Firestore检索数据。我的数据结构是这样的:users-name@xxx.com-moredata有没有办法让我把name@xxx.com改成名字?我看不到更改文档名称的方法。 最佳答案 我认为最好的方法是从'name@xxx.com'获取数据并将其上传到一个名为'name'的新文档,然后删除旧文档。举个例子:constfirestore=firebase.firestore();//getthedatafrom'name@xxx.com'firestore.collecti